Find out the error according to the grammar and context of
the given sentences. If there is no error, mark option 5, i.e. No error. (Ignore the punctuation errors, if any.) Understanding how particles such as (1)/ electrons travel vast distances in space (2)/ or how they acquire ultra-high energy (3)/ have been a long-standing puzzle in astrophysics .(4)/ No error (5)Solution
The subject of the sentence is "Understanding", which is singular. Therefore, the verb should also be singular, i.e., "has been", not "have been."The confusion arises because "particles" and "electrons" are plural, but they are part of the object of the sentence. The subject of the sentence is "Understanding" (singular), so the correct verb form is "has been."Thus, the error is in (4) where "has been" should be used instead of "have been.""Understanding how particles such as electrons travel vast distances in space or how they acquire ultra-high energy has been a long-standing puzzle in astrophysics.
